A subsea engineering company in Aberdeen seeks a Mechanical Design Engineer. This role involves creating innovative designs for electro-mechanical systems, utilizing tools like Inventor and MathCAD. The successful candidate will develop detailed designs, collaborate with electrical engineers, and ensure quality control throughout the project lifecycle.
Ideal applicants will have:
- a degree in Mechanical Engineering
- relevant experience
- a passion for continual improvement
- strong communication skills
